Altenburg District #48 board sets timetable to recruit and hire a new principal/superintendent

Altenburg District #48 Board of Education · June 12, 2025

At its June 12 meeting the Altenburg District #48 Board of Education heard a recruitment plan from MARE that schedules the job posting for early September, candidate interviews in late October and a special November meeting to select a hire.

The Altenburg District #48 Board of Education on June 12 heard a recruitment plan from Darryl Pannier of MARE outlining steps and dates for hiring a new principal/superintendent.

Pannier told the board the position will be posted tentatively Sept. 2–30, 2025. The board agreed to move its regular October meeting to Oct. 14 and to hold a closed session after that open session to select candidates to interview. Interviews are planned for the week of Oct. 20, and the board will meet in a special session on Nov. 6 to make a hiring decision, per the timeline presented.

The plan was presented as a proposed timetable and process; the minutes record the presentation but do not show further public discussion or a formal board vote specific to the timetable. The minutes identify Darryl Pannier as the presenter and list Superintendent Debbie Haertling among those present for the meeting.

Next steps set by the board staff include posting the position in September and scheduling candidate interviews and the November special meeting to finalize the hire.
